About Searchable
We're building the future of AI search visibility. As ChatGPT, Claude, and Perplexity reshape how people find information, we help brands understand and optimize their presence in this new landscape. Backed by top angels and VCs, we're creating the essential platform for the AI search era.

About the Role
Be an early employee at a venture-backed startup with proven founders who have multiple exits. Own the entire design vision - from brand identity to user experience. Work directly with the founders to shape product strategy. Build the design culture and team as we scale. Have your work impact millions of users across the world's biggest brands.
About You
We need someone with an insatiable hunger to create beautiful, functional products. Someone who:
- Obsesses over details others miss - the perfect curve, the right spacing, the subtle animation.
- Thinks in systems, not just screens.
- Can sell their vision with conviction but adapt with humility.
- Thrives in ambiguity and loves the challenge of defining what doesn't exist yet.
- Wants their work to be remembered, not just used.
What you'll do
Define our visual language and design system from scratch. Create intuitive interfaces for complex AI and data visualization challenges. Shape how brands understand and improve their AI search presence. Build a world-class design culture as we grow. Collaborate directly with engineering to ensure pixel-perfect implementation.
Benefits and Comp
Top market salary in London, performance bonus and real equity. 25 days paid vacation and leading parental and childcare policies. Relocation bonus and support to make your move to London smooth (if needed).
